Logica Plus+: The Wardrobe as Domestic Architecture

The concept of storage evolves radically with Logica Plus+. Here, the wardrobe transcends its original function to transform into true architecture capable of redesigning the home’s volumes. Thanks to advanced modularity, this Tomasella system integrates diverse functions into a single harmonic vision: it can frame a TV area, hide a complete workstation, or house beauty corners and laundry areas.

The dynamic rhythm between closed modules and open niches allows Logica Plus+ to transition effortlessly from the living area to the sleeping area, demonstrating a versatile soul that organizes space with intelligence and aesthetic purity.

Transparencies and Reflections with the Joyce Sideboard

While Logica Plus+ defines the space, the Joyce sideboard interprets it through lightness. Characterized by a metal structure that slenders its silhouette, Joyce transforms the concept of a sideboard into a scenographic display case. Glass doors allow objects to be showcased with discreet refinement, while the backlit backrest creates a play of reflections and textures that expands the room’s visual depth. It is a narrative element that changes its face with the light, bringing a soft and evocative atmosphere to the living room.

Atlante System and Glove Boiserie: The Heart of the Living Room

The Atlante system remains the gravitational center of Tomasella’s research for the living area. In the new UNIT_AT145 configuration, the system plays with suspended volumes and material contrasts to create a high-impact domestic backdrop. The presence of illuminated glass wall units and sleek linear bases provides a harmonious and contemporary visual rhythm.

Completing this vision is the Glove boiserie (wall paneling), a textured insert that adds a sensory level and comfort to the rigidity of the volumes. With the integration of the Glove boiserie into the Atlante system, the furniture becomes more welcoming and “human,” transforming the living room into a space that is not just inhabited, but actively tells the story of those who live there.
